explain the types of frequency distribution in statistics




Answers

The two types of frequency distributions are Discrete Frequency Distribution and Grouped Frequency Distribution

What are the types of distribution?

The two types of frequency distributions are;

Discrete Frequency Distribution:Grouped Frequency Distribution

When the data consists of discrete, separate values, this sort of distribution is used. It displays the frequency or number of occurrences of each value.

The data is often expressed in a table with two columns: one for distinct values and another for the frequencies of those values.

This distribution is utilized when the data is continuous and has a wide range of values. It entails categorizing the data into intervals or classes and then calculating the frequency of values that fall within each interval.
